Transaction d9b6918487010eb335ef93486af7806158b4f88204e4ada702dae5f32e6de106
1 Input
1 Output
-
d9b6918487010eb335ef93486af7806158b4f88204e4ada702dae5f32e6de106:0
- value
- 303682591
- script pubkey
- OP_0 OP_PUSHBYTES_20 31c5b1500ffbf861a42ce34720d66b9c7021f0c1
- address
- bc1qx8zmz5q0l0uxrfpvudrjp4ntn3czruxp6emgg6